Coupling direct powder deposition with spark plasma sintering: a new approach towards rapid prototyping

In this paper, we propose a modified material jetting technology based on a piezoelectric-driven powder deposition, hence direct powder deposition (DPD), combined with pressure-assisted rapid sintering. This is a new approach toward the rapid production of metal and ceramic materials with complex geometries. The combined deposition of two loose powders within the same container, layer by layer, allows realizing complex shapes without the use of any binder or dispersing medium. The resulting green sample is then sintered by field assisted sintering (FAST) or spark plasma sintering (SPS) operating in a pseudo-isostatic mode. This combination of DPD and FAST/SPS allows great versatility, as it can be extended to a wide range of materials and composites without any significant modification of the setup. Moreover, the use of FAST/SPS densification allows the realization of fully sintered samples in less than one hour.
